Job description

Vertec Group is recruiting for a Document Controller on a permanent basis for our long-standing client - a leading specialist Mechanical and Electrical service provider, delivering projects directly for clients and Tier 1 main contractors across London and the surrounding areas.

We are seeking an organised and detail-oriented individual who thrives in a fast-paced environment and is keen to play a key role in supporting project delivery within Heathrow Airport. This position will be based primarily on projects located airside and therefore requires successful applicants to obtain a full airside pass, which will be processed by our client., * Manage and maintain project documentation in accordance with company procedures and client requirements.

  • Ensure that all project documents are correctly numbered, controlled, and distributed.
  • Support project teams with document submittals, transmittals, and version control.
  • Maintain up-to-date registers of drawings, specifications, RFIs, and technical documents.
  • Liaise with engineers, project managers, and external stakeholders to ensure timely submission and approval of documentation.
  • Implement document control processes to ensure compliance with quality management systems.
  • Coordinate the archiving and retrieval of project documentation for completed works.
  • Assist in preparing documentation for audits and compliance reviews.
